The Breastfeeding Coalition of Washington (BCW) is a statewide network of hundreds of individuals and over 20 local community coalitions and partner organizations. Our mission is to promote, protect, and support breastfeeding as vital to the health of our communities.

We work to increase initiation, duration and exclusivity rates of breastfeeding/chestfeeding through promotion projects, education and resource sharing with the larger aim of establishing human milk feeding as the cultural norm in Washington. Our vision is that Washington state champions breastfeeding as the foundation for lifelong health and wellness. We strive to eliminate all breastfeeding barriers, and to ensure all Washington families have equitable access to lactation support and resources. Our work influences parents and families, communities, organizations, and the larger sociocultural environment, all of which impact breastfeeding.

BCW Statewide Goals

Advocate and implement best practices that support lactation within hospitals, birthing facilities, health clinics, workplaces, and childcare facilities.

Promote and protect a supportive environment for breastfeeding, chest feeding, and the use of human milk.

Increase equitable access to accurate information, lactation services, and culturally relevant, person-centered support.

Promote success among coalition members by facilitating communication, diverse membership representation, and visibility in local communities.
